Birdman or (The Unexpected Virtue of Ignorance)

Birdman or (The Unexpected Virtue of Ignorance)2014



Mike Shiner:
Give me a cue again.

Riggan:
Okay. "Hey, I'm the wrong person to ask. I don't actually know the man, I've heard his name mentioned in passing. I don't know, you'd have to know the particulars. I think what you're saying..."

Mike Shiner:
Hey, can I make a suggestion, do you mind?

Riggan:
Yeah, yeah sure, no not at all.

Mike Shiner:
Okay, just stay with me. "I'm the wrong person to ask," he says, but what is that, what is the intention in that? Is he fed up with the subject so he's changing it, is he deflecting guilt over the marriage? And here's the thing, you've got four lines after that that all say the same thing. "I didn't even know the man, I only heard his name mentioned in passing, I wouldn't know, you'd have to know the particulars..." The point is, you don't know the guy, we f - king get it. Make it work with one line: "I didn't even know the man." Right?

Riggan:
Right. Yeah. You know my lines too, huh?

Mike Shiner:
Can we not get hung up on knowing lines?
